So i got a new battery for my car from autozone, and for whatever reason the employee recommended me getting these red and green pads to put over my battery terminals.They were an extra $5 and he said they eat and keep corrosion off of your terminals...so i shrugged and said sure why not. I have never heard of such a thing,my question is did this guy just sell me snake oil? It's all good if he got over on me it was just $5...but is this a legit item? i tried google and can't find any info on it.

 

the pads are the red and green circles over my terminal posts.

They are anti-corrosion pads. 

Last time I had the battery on my car changed (from new it had to be changed within 3 months damn Vauxhall :unimpressed:) I had those put on and this was from the actual car dealership so they're legit. They basically stop the terminals corroding, I don't know why you were charged in the UK most places i've had my car serviced at put these on for free.
